#green-stripe{background:#2a4061;color:#fff}@media(min-width:576px){#green-stripe .bg-holder{background-image:var(--green-stripe-bg-img,none);background-repeat:no-repeat;background-size:cover}}#green-stripe .section-content{padding-bottom:60px;padding-top:60px}#green-stripe h2{font-size:46px;margin:0 auto;padding:0 1.5rem}@media(min-width:576px){#green-stripe h2{font-size:62px;padding:0}}@media(min-width:992px){#green-stripe h2{max-width:700px}}#green-stripe .buttons-container{gap:1rem}#green-stripe .buttons-container .btn-tt{border-width:1px}#green-stripe a.btn{min-width:175px}html:lang(ja) #green-stripe h2{font-size:1.6rem;margin:0 auto;padding:0 1.5rem}@media(min-width:576px){html:lang(ja) #green-stripe h2{font-size:2.4rem;padding:0}}.btn-tt.white-background{background-color:#fff}.btn-dark-txt{color:#051329!important}.btn-border-white{border:1px solid #fff}.glossary-pages{background-color:#fff;padding:80px 30px}.glossary-pages h3{font-family:Open Sans,sans-serif;font-size:22px;font-weight:700}@media(min-width:992px){.glossary-pages h3{font-size:24px}}@media(min-width:1400px){.glossary-pages h3{font-size:30px;line-height:127%}}.glossary-pages .page-link{align-items:center;background-color:#40be46;border-radius:4px;display:flex;font-family:Open Sans,sans-serif;font-size:14px;font-weight:700;height:40px;justify-content:center;line-height:152%;min-width:313px;padding:10px 80px}.glossary-pages .page-link:focus{outline:none}.glossary-pages .page-link:hover .fa{opacity:1;right:65px;transition:all .2s ease-in-out}.glossary-pages .page-link .fa{opacity:0;right:70px}.glossary-pages .single-content h6{font-weight:700}.glossary-pages .single-content h6,.glossary-pages .single-content p{color:#2b2b2b;font-family:Open Sans,sans-serif;font-size:16px;line-height:142%}.glossary-pages .single-content p{font-weight:400;margin-bottom:30px}@media(min-width:1400px){.glossary-pages .single-content{padding-right:20px!important}}@media(min-width:1024px){.glossary-pages{padding:100px 15px}}@media(min-width:1400px){.glossary-pages{padding:120px 15px}}.single-glossary .generic-hero .section-content{min-height:auto;padding-bottom:42px!important;padding-top:42px!important}@media(min-width:992px){.single-glossary .generic-hero .section-content{min-height:282px}}.single-glossary .generic-hero .section-content p{margin:0!important}.single-glossary .generic-hero .section-content .btn-green{margin-top:42px!important;padding:14px 32px}.single-glossary .generic-hero .section-content .btn-green.arrow:not(.btn-tt):after{margin-top:4px}.generic-hero{background-position:bottom;background-repeat:no-repeat;background-size:auto 100%;position:relative}@media(min-device-width:320px)and (max-device-width:480px){.generic-hero.contain-bg{background-position:bottom;background-size:contain}}.generic-hero.bg-right{background-position:100% 100%!important}@media(min-width:1550px){.generic-hero.bg-right{background-position:bottom 0 right calc(50% - 20rem)!important}}.generic-hero h1 .left-separator{padding-left:2.6rem;position:relative;text-align:left}@media(max-device-width:768px){.generic-hero h1 .left-separator{padding-left:1.3rem}}.generic-hero h1 .left-separator:before{content:"|";left:5px;position:absolute;top:0}.generic-hero .section-content{padding:5rem 1.5rem;position:relative;z-index:1}@media(min-width:992px){.generic-hero .section-content{align-items:center;display:flex;flex-direction:column;justify-content:center;min-height:370px}}@media(max-device-width:768px){.generic-hero .section-content{padding-bottom:8rem;padding-top:8rem}}@media(min-device-width:320px)and (max-device-width:480px){.generic-hero .section-content{padding-bottom:6rem;padding-top:6rem}}@media(min-width:992px){.generic-hero .section-content.text-left{align-items:flex-start;text-align:left!important}}.generic-hero .section-content p.mx-0{margin-left:0!important;margin-right:0!important}@media(max-device-width:768px){.generic-hero.video_bg{padding-bottom:8rem}}.generic-hero video{height:100%;left:0;object-fit:cover;object-position:70% 100%;position:absolute;top:0;width:100%;z-index:0}.devops-breadcrumbs{align-items:center;color:#6e8389;display:flex;flex-wrap:wrap;gap:8px;padding:0 0 40px;width:100%}.devops-breadcrumbs .separator{align-items:center;display:flex;height:100%}.devops-breadcrumbs .separator svg{height:auto;width:auto}.devops-breadcrumbs a{color:inherit;text-transform:capitalize}.definition-callout{background-color:#fff;border:1px solid #40be46;margin:2rem 0;padding:30px 25px 25px;position:relative}@media(min-width:1200px){.definition-callout{margin-bottom:3rem;margin-top:15px;padding:40px 32px 27px}}.definition-callout h2{background-color:inherit;color:#40be46;font-family:Open Sans,sans-serif;font-size:28px;font-weight:700;left:18px;line-height:122%;padding:0 5px;position:absolute;top:-17px}@media(min-width:768px){.definition-callout h2{font-size:1.875rem;left:20px;line-height:142%;padding:0 10px;top:-26px}.definition-callout p{font-size:1.125rem;line-height:1.845rem}}.definition-callout p:last-child{margin-bottom:0}.content-with-toc h2,.content-with-toc h3,.content-with-toc h4,.content-with-toc h5,.content-with-toc h6{color:#40be46;font-family:Open Sans,sans-serif;font-weight:600}.content-with-toc h2{font-size:28px;font-weight:700;line-height:122%}@media(min-width:768px){.content-with-toc h2{font-size:1.875rem;line-height:142%;margin-bottom:1.5rem}.content-with-toc h3{font-size:1.375rem;line-height:160%}.content-with-toc ol,.content-with-toc p,.content-with-toc ul{font-size:1.125rem;line-height:1.845rem}}.content-with-toc ol li+li{margin-top:1rem}.content-with-toc *{max-width:100%}.content-with-toc img{height:auto}.content-with-toc section{scroll-margin:8rem}.content-with-toc section:not(:last-child){border-bottom:1px solid #40be46;margin-bottom:2rem;padding-bottom:3.333rem}@media(min-width:768px){.content-with-toc section:not(:last-child){margin-bottom:3rem}}.content-with-toc section>:last-child{margin-bottom:0}.toc-wrapper{height:100%;position:relative}.toc-wrapper .items{border-left:1px solid #758297}.toc-wrapper a{color:#758297;font-weight:400;padding:.2rem 1rem;position:relative;transition:color .25s,background-color .25s}@media(min-width:768px){.toc-wrapper a{font-size:1.125rem;padding:.5rem 1rem}}.toc-wrapper a:before{background-color:#40be46;bottom:0;content:"";height:100%;left:0;position:absolute;top:0;transition:opacity .25s;width:3px}.toc-wrapper a:hover{color:#40be46!important}.toc-wrapper a:hover:before{opacity:1!important}.toc-wrapper a.visible{background-color:#f1f9ff;color:#40be46}.toc-wrapper a.visible:before{opacity:1}.toc-wrapper a.visible+.visible,.toc-wrapper a:not(.visible){background-color:transparent;color:#758297}.toc-wrapper a.visible+.visible:before,.toc-wrapper a:not(.visible):before{opacity:0}.additional-resources{padding-bottom:4rem;padding-top:0}@media(min-width:768px){.additional-resources{padding-bottom:6.25rem;padding-top:0}}.additional-resources.pt{padding-top:3.12rem}@media(min-width:768px){.additional-resources.pt{padding-bottom:5.62rem;padding-top:5.62rem}}.additional-resources h2{color:#0c1d37;font-size:1.5rem;line-height:1.5;padding-bottom:2rem;text-align:left}@media(min-width:768px){.additional-resources h2{font-size:2rem;line-height:2.75rem;padding-bottom:2.5rem;text-align:center}}@media(max-device-width:768px){.additional-resources .resource-card{margin:0 auto;max-width:424px;width:100%}}.additional-resources .resource-card .card{background:#fff;border:1px solid #cbcbcb;padding:1.375rem 1.563rem 1.25rem 2.063rem;transition:all .32s ease}.additional-resources .resource-card .card .category{line-height:1.188rem;text-decoration-color:#005304!important;text-decoration-thickness:2px!important;text-underline-offset:10px;transition:all .32s ease}.additional-resources .resource-card .card .text{line-height:151.68%;min-height:70px}.additional-resources .resource-card .card .link{line-height:1.375rem;max-width:100%!important;position:relative;transition:all .32s ease}.additional-resources .resource-card .card .link:after{content:"";display:inline-block!important;font-family:FontAwesome;font-size:.8em;font-weight:400;opacity:0;position:relative;top:1px;transition:all .32s ease;visibility:hidden;width:0}@media(min-width:992px){.additional-resources .resource-card .card:hover{background:#2a4061}.additional-resources .resource-card .card:hover .category,.additional-resources .resource-card .card:hover .description,.additional-resources .resource-card .card:hover .text{color:#fff!important}}.additional-resources .resource-card .card:hover .category{text-decoration-color:#40be46!important;transition:all .32s ease}.additional-resources .resource-card .card:hover .link{color:#40be46!important;transition:all .32s ease}.additional-resources .resource-card .card:hover .link:after{opacity:1;padding-left:5px;visibility:visible;width:.8em}.additional-resources .resource-card.card-white-bg .card{background-color:#fff}.additional-resources .resource-card.card-white-bg .card:hover{background:#2a4061}.additional-resources .resource-card.card-white-bg .card:hover .category,.additional-resources .resource-card.card-white-bg .card:hover .text{color:#fff!important}.additional-resources .card-grid{display:grid;gap:1.25rem;grid-template-columns:repeat(auto-fit,minmax(20.5rem,1fr));justify-content:center}@media(min-width:768px){.additional-resources .card-grid{gap:2rem}}.additional-resources .card-grid .card{border-radius:8px;display:flex;flex-direction:column;padding:24px 28px}.additional-resources .card-grid .card span{margin-top:auto}.more-about-topics-tabs .nav-tabs{border-bottom:none;gap:1rem;justify-content:center;margin-bottom:2.5rem}.more-about-topics-tabs .nav-link{border:none;border-bottom:2px solid transparent;color:#7b7b7b;font-size:20px;line-height:120%;min-width:142px;padding:.5rem 1rem}.more-about-topics-tabs .nav-link:hover{border-color:transparent;color:#40be46}.more-about-topics-tabs .nav-link.active{background-color:transparent;border-bottom-color:#40be46;color:#40be46}.more-about-topics-tabs .excerpt-grid{display:grid;gap:2rem;justify-content:center}@media(min-width:768px){.more-about-topics-tabs .excerpt-grid{gap:4rem;grid-template-columns:repeat(auto-fit,386px)}}.more-about-topics-tabs .excerpt{background-color:#fff;border:1px solid #cecece;border-radius:3px;display:flex;flex-direction:column;gap:1rem;padding:2rem}.more-about-topics-tabs .excerpt>*{margin-bottom:0}.more-about-topics-tabs .excerpt img{aspect-ratio:1.2/1;border-radius:5px;box-shadow:2px 4px 7.1px rgba(0,0,0,.12);height:auto;object-fit:cover;overflow:hidden;width:100%}.more-about-topics-tabs .excerpt h4{color:#3f3f3f;display:flex;flex-direction:column;font-size:18px;font-weight:700;gap:.8rem;line-height:100%}.more-about-topics-tabs .excerpt h4:after{background-color:#40be46;content:"";height:4px;width:80px}.more-about-topics-tabs .excerpt a{display:flex;font-weight:600;gap:8px;margin-left:auto;margin-top:auto}.more-about-topics-tabs .excerpt a:after{content:"";font-family:FontAwesome;font-size:12px;left:0;position:relative;top:4px;transition:left .25s}.more-about-topics-tabs .excerpt a:hover:after{left:3px}.more-about-topics-tabs .links-grid{display:grid;gap:0 2.5rem}@media(min-width:768px){.more-about-topics-tabs .links-grid{grid-template-columns:repeat(2,1fr)}}.more-about-topics-tabs .links-grid a{border-bottom:1px solid #40be46;display:block;font-size:18px;padding:1.5rem 0;transition:color .25s}.more-about-topics-tabs .links-grid a:not(:hover){color:#2a4061}.more-about-topics-tabs .links-grid a:last-child{border-bottom:none}@media(min-width:768px){.more-about-topics-tabs .links-grid a:nth-last-child(-n+2){border-bottom:none}}main.single-neighborhood h4{color:#40be46;font-family:Open Sans,sans-serif;font-size:24px;font-weight:600;line-height:156%;margin-bottom:1rem}main.single-neighborhood section#content{color:#0c1d37;padding-bottom:30px}@media(min-width:768px){main.single-neighborhood section#content{padding-bottom:170px}}@media(min-width:1200px){main.single-neighborhood section#content .content-wrapper{display:grid;gap:3rem;grid-template-columns:auto 49rem;justify-content:space-between}}@media(min-width:1400px){main.single-neighborhood section#content .content-wrapper{grid-template-columns:25.75rem minmax(auto,49rem)}}main.single-neighborhood section#content .post-excerpt-callout{margin-top:2rem}@media(min-width:768px){main.single-neighborhood section#content .post-excerpt-callout{margin-top:90px}}main.single-neighborhood section#content .post-excerpt-callout img{height:auto;width:100%}main.single-neighborhood section#content .sticky-sidebar{padding-bottom:1rem}@media(min-width:768px){main.single-neighborhood section#content .sticky-sidebar{position:sticky;top:10rem}}main.single-neighborhood section#addition-resources{background-color:#f6f9fc;padding:30px 0}@media(min-width:768px){main.single-neighborhood section#addition-resources{padding:6.25rem 0 3.25rem}}main.single-neighborhood section#addition-resources div.additional-resources{padding-bottom:0}main.single-neighborhood section#addition-resources h2{padding-bottom:1rem}@media(min-width:768px){main.single-neighborhood section#addition-resources h2{padding-bottom:2rem}}main.single-neighborhood section#addition-resources .card:not(:hover){background-color:#fff}main.single-neighborhood section#addition-resources a{text-transform:capitalize!important}main.single-neighborhood section#more-about-tabs{background-color:#f5f5f5;padding:30px 0 4rem}@media(min-width:768px){main.single-neighborhood section#more-about-tabs{padding:100px 0}}main.single-neighborhood section#more-about-tabs h2{font-family:Open Sans,sans-serif;font-size:1.5rem;font-weight:700;line-height:1.5;margin-bottom:2rem}@media(min-width:768px){main.single-neighborhood section#more-about-tabs h2{font-size:2rem;line-height:2.75rem}}main.single-neighborhood section#green-stripe h2{line-height:142%}